Abstract

A novcl type of invcrter is proposed for grid-connection of new energy power generation. The proposed inverter is based on buck-boost operation well-known in DC chopper circuits. This inverter acts as an interface between the generator and the grid and has a distinctive feature of realizing the inverse load flow with a wide range of input DC voltage. A control scherne of DC reactor current is also introduced in order to reduce losses in the DC reactor. The performance and characteristics of the proposed inverter is discussed in computer simulation.
